Study Details

This study aims to investigate the characteristics of the microbiota-gut-brain axis in pediatric patients with obsessive-compulsive disorder (OCD) through performing an integrated analysis of gut microbiota, serum metabolomics, neuroimaging and electroencephalography (EEG), conducted before and after treatment with selective serotonin reuptake inhibitors (SSRIs). The results will be compared with those of pediatric OCD paitents comorbid with tic disorder (TD) and healthy controls. The findings are expected to further elucidate the potential pathogenesis of OCD, providing a theoretical basis for identifying novel clinical intervention targets and optimizing treatment strategies.

Study Design

Enrollment
125 participants (estimated)

Arms

  • Arm: pediatric OCD patients
    Drug-naïve or drug-free pediatric patients with OCD will be enrolled in this group. After data collection, they will receive treatment with SSRIs.
  • Arm: pediatric OCD patients comorbid with TD
    Drug-naïve or drug-free pediatric OCD patients comorbid with TD will be enrolled in this group. After data collection, they will receive treatment with SSRIs and antipsychotics.
  • Arm: healthy controls
    Healthy children and adolescents will be enrolled in this group for data collection.

Primary Outcome Measure

Changes in the diversity and composition of the microbiome before and after drug treatment. [ Time Frame: Before and after treatment with SSRIs for 12 weeks ]
